Upper Muley Twist Canyon
This view of Upper Muley Twist Canyon is seen just before you descend back into the canyon from the Reef Crest. The loop section of the route follows the Reef crest on the right. Wow! Is that ever a spectacular scramble! Look closely and you'll see Saddle Arch, the landmark which indicates the conclusion (or beginning) of the loop section of this hike. Capitol Reef National Park, Fall, 2005.
